CNG association asks public transporters to get fitness certificates of their vehicles.

ISLAMABAD -- All Pakistan Compressed Natural Gas (CNG) Association has asked public transporters to get five years fitness certificates of their CNG Cylinders from authorized cylinder testing laboratories, failing which their cylinders would be confiscated besides imposing heavy fined by traffic police and district administration of their respective areas.

In a statement, the association directed public transporters including the owners of Toyota High Ace, wagons, coasters, buses, Mazda, Suzuki Carry, Taxis, rikshas and other private vehicles to get certificates from authorized workshops of their respective areas.
